Types of Art Insurance
There are several different types of art insurance policies available to suit the needs of collectors, artists, galleries, and other art-related businesses Some common types of art insurance include:
1 Fine Art Insurance: This type of policy is designed specifically for collectors and covers individual pieces or entire collections of fine art Fine art insurance typically provides coverage for damage, theft, loss, and other risks.
2 Artist’s Insurance: This type of policy is tailored for artists and provides coverage for their own works of art Artist’s insurance can help protect against damage to works in progress, as well as theft or loss of completed pieces.
3 Gallery Insurance: Galleries often have unique insurance needs, as they may be responsible for storing, displaying, and selling valuable works of art Gallery insurance can provide coverage for a variety of risks, including damage to artwork on display, theft, and more.
